在使用Oracle的MERGE INTO語句時,可以通過以下方法處理錯誤:
使用異常處理語句:在MERGE INTO語句的后面添加異常處理語句,如BEGIN EXCEPTION END; 來處理可能出現(xiàn)的異常情況。
使用SAVE EXCEPTIONS子句:在MERGE INTO語句中添加SAVE EXCEPTIONS子句,可以在出現(xiàn)錯誤時保存錯誤信息,然后通過查詢DBA_ERRORS視圖來查看錯誤信息。
使用日志表來記錄錯誤信息:在MERGE INTO語句中添加LOG ERRORS INTO子句,可以將出現(xiàn)錯誤的記錄插入到指定的日志表中,以便后續(xù)處理。
使用錯誤處理函數(shù):定義一個錯誤處理函數(shù)來處理MERGE INTO語句中可能出現(xiàn)的錯誤,可以更靈活地處理異常情況。
總之,在使用Oracle的MERGE INTO語句時,需要考慮可能出現(xiàn)的錯誤情況,并采取適當?shù)姆椒ㄟM行處理,以確保數(shù)據(jù)操作的安全性和準確性。